Fudgy Black Bean Brownies

Fudgy Black Bean Brownies

Rich black beans and decadent cocoa are blended into a velvety batter and baked until perfectly fudgy for a protein-packed treat.

NUTRITION

462kcal
Protein
57.4g
Fat
15.4g
Carbs
30.2g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

0.5 cup black beans

1.5 scoop chocolate protein powder

1 large egg

1 tbsp almond butter

1 tbsp unsweetened cocoa powder

0.25 tsp baking powder

0.5 tsp vanilla extract

0.13 tsp sea salt

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and lightly grease a small oven-safe ramekin or mini loaf pan.

  • 2

    Drain and thoroughly rinse the black beans under cold water to ensure a clean flavor base for the batter.

  • 3

    Place the rinsed beans, chocolate protein powder, egg, almond butter, cocoa powder, baking powder, vanilla, and sea salt into a small food processor.

  • 4

    Process the mixture on high until completely smooth and creamy, stopping to scrape down the sides as needed to ensure no bean fragments remain.

  • 5

    Transfer the batter into the prepared baking dish and smooth the top with a spatula.

  • 6

    Bake for 18 to 22 minutes, or until the edges are firm and the center is just set but still slightly soft.

  • 7

    Remove from the oven and allow the brownie to cool in the dish for at least 10 minutes to set the fudgy texture before serving.
